Modifying the size distribution of microbubble contrast agents for high-frequency subharmonic imaging

Purpose: Subharmonic imaging is of interest for high frequency (>10 MHz) nonlinear imaging, because it can specifically detect the response of ultrasound contrast agents (UCA).
